7efad83d430f4d824f2aaa75edea5106f6ff8aae 09-Sep-2014 Elliott Hughes <enh@google.com> Ensure __set_errno is still visible on LP32.

The use of the .hidden directive to avoid going via the PLT for
__set_errno had the side-effect of actually making __set_errno
hidden (which is odd because assembler directives don't usually
affect symbols defined in a different file --- you can't even
create a weak reference to a symbol that's defined in a different
file).

This change switches the system call stubs over to a new always-hidden
__set_errno_internal and has a visible __set_errno on LP32 just for
binary compatibility with old NDK apps.

faa0fdb1194172f578f973097d61e580bce528dc 16-Jan-2013 Matthieu Castet <matthieu.castet@gmail.com> arm syscall : for eabi call_default don't use stack

In the default case, we don't need to use the stack, we can save r7 with
ip register (that what does eglibc).

This allow to fix vfork data corruption
(see 3884bfe9661955543ce203c60f9225bbdf33f6bb), because vfork now don't
use the stack.
